About Master of Science - Geology

The graduate program in Geology offers two tracks to a Master of Science degree in Geology: a thesis-based option in which students pursue a research project and a non-thesis option that culminates in a comprehensive examination. Students who successfully complete the program will upgrade their educational qualifications and be able to advance to doctoral programs or professional positions that require an in-depth knowledge of geologic topics such as tectonics, hydrogeology, environmental geology, and geologic hazards. The University's location in the state capital provides direct access to many local, federal, and state agencies through internship and fieldwork opportunities.

Students who are interested in pursuing the thesis-based option should contact potential advisors prior to application to the program. All students enter the program in the non-thesis option and those interested in a thesis must apply to switch to the thesis-based option with the agreement of a faculty advisor.

Graduate students who want to engage in teaching can request an appointment as a Graduate Teaching Associate. Graduate Teaching Associates have the opportunity to teach one to two lower division laboratory courses per semester and are paid at a rate commensurate with their teaching load.

All work toward the degree must be completed within a seven-year period. The general University requirements for graduate degrees are explained in the "Graduate Studies" section of this Catalog or visit the Geology Department's website.
